We are seeking to appoint a Postdoctoral Researcher for a 14 month position in ice sheet numerical modelling. The role is part of CryoTipping: Detecting marine ice sheet instability, an international collaboration led by Northumbria University and funded by the European Space Agency.

ABOUT THE ROLE

You will develop new approaches to detect tipping points in numerical simulations of West Antarctica’s future evolution.

The specific goal is to make use of state-of-the-art Earth Observation datasets to initialise an ice sheet model and develop new methods for identifying tipping points numerical simulations of Thwaites’ future evolution. This work will contribute towards advancing our understanding of whether and when tipping points might be crossed.

ABOUT THE TEAM

You will join Northumbria University’s Future of Ice on Earth research group, one of the largest and most active ice-sheet modelling community in the world and the UK Centre for Polar Observation and Modelling (CPOM), which provides national capability in satellite observations and numerical modelling of Earth’s polar regions. The project provides opportunities to collaborate closely with international partners, participate in scientific project meetings, and present your work at leading conferences and workshops in glaciology, tipping points, numerical modelling, and Earth Observation.

ABOUT YOU

We welcome applications from candidates with a strong interest in climate science and ice dynamics. You should have:

  • A background in physics, applied mathematics, Earth science, or a related discipline
  • Skills in numerical modelling, programming, and handling large datasets
  • Interest in nonlinear dynamics and complex systems
  • Motivation to contribute to key scientific questions about climate change and Earth’s future
